Examples of duties

What you’ll do:

As the Survey Crew Supervisor, you’ll oversee daily field survey activities, guide and train crew members, and ensure all collected data meets professional, state, and industry standards. You will play a critical role in supporting public works designs, boundary surveys, topographical surveys, and construction layout by operating specialized survey instruments, data collectors, and GPS equipment.

Key Responsibilities Include:

  • Leading and supervising survey crew personnel and maintaining a safe, organized worksite
  • Setting priorities, managing schedules, and monitoring progress to ensure accuracy and compliance, as well as maximizing efficiency
  • Collecting, reviewing, and reporting detailed field data and daily activity logs
  • Operating and maintaining survey instruments and equipment
  • Preparing field sketches, interpreting construction plans, and checking data for accuracy
  • Supporting special projects, public requests, and emergency operations
  • Continuously improving field methods, procedures, and overall workflow
  • Provide Quality Assurance and Quality Control
  • Perform basic property research and Autocad functions

About Charleston County Government

Charleston County is located along the southeastern coast of South Carolina, The County encompasses approximately 919 square miles of land, marshes, rivers, and wetlands with a coastline that stretches nearly 100 miles along the Atlantic Ocean.

Charleston County's rich blend of culture, economic activity, environmental beauty, and historic tapestry makes it one of the most distinguished counties in the nation.
